Output 0758592f1e8ba609d4ab33bb1f03c28f9d62e108d148c1a744ab8596913c350b:1
- value
- 34295
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f2fff24ec9d9b12db89ccba46a029720ddcd9ae
- address
- bc1qruhl7f8vnkd39kufejaydgpfwgxaekdwh8p00n
- transaction
- 0758592f1e8ba609d4ab33bb1f03c28f9d62e108d148c1a744ab8596913c350b